What companies run services between Bellshill, North Lanarkshire, Scotland and Perth, Scotland?

ScotRail operates a train from Glasgow Queen Street to Perth hourly. Tickets cost £13–23 and the journey takes 1h 11m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Bellshill DSS to Leonard Street via Harthill Services and Airport in around 2h 26m.
